Desenvolvimento Web Moderno com JavaScript!
Descrição: Domine Web, 14 Cursos + Projetos, Javascript, Angular, React, Vue, Node, HTML, CSS, jQuery, Bootstrap, Webpack, Gulp e MySQL
Plataforma: Udemy
JavaScript: Fundamentos
- Organização Básica de um Código JS
- Comentários de Código
- O Básico de Var, Let e Const
- Tipagem Fraca
- Tipos em JavaScript: Number
- Number: Alguns Cuidados
- Usando Math
- Tipos em JavaScript: String
- Usando Template Strings
- Tipos em JavaScript: Boolean
- Tipos em JavaScript: Array
- Tipos em JavaScript: Object
- Entendendo o Null & Undefined
- Quase Tudo é Função!!!
- Exemplos Básicos de Funções #1
- Exemplos Básicos de Funções #2
- Declaração de Variáveis com Var #1
- Declaração de Variáveis com Var #2
- Declaração de Variáveis com Let
- Usando Var em Loop #1
- Usando Let em Loop #1
- Usando Var em Loop #2
- Usando Let em Loop #2
- Entendendo o Hoisting
- Função Vs Objeto
- Par Nome/Valor
- Notação Ponto
- Operadores: Atribuição
- Operadores: Destructuring #1
- Operadores: Destructuring #2
- Operadores: Destructuring #3
- Operadores: Destructuring #4
- Operadores: Aritméticos
- Operadores: Relacionais
- Operadores: Lógicos
- Operadores: Unários
- Operadores: Ternário
- Tratamento de Erro (Try/Catch/Throw)
Java Script: Estruturas de Controle
Java Script: Função
- Cidadão de Primeira Linha
- Parâmetros e Retorno são Opcionais
- Parâmetros Variáveis
- Parâmetro Padrão
- this e a Função bind #1
- this e a Função bind #2
- Funções Arrow #1
- Funções Arrow #2
- Funções Arrow #3
- Funções Anônimas
- Funções Callback #1
- Funções Callback #2
- Funções Callback #3
- Funções Construtoras
- Tipos de Declaração
- Contexto Léxico
- Closures
- Função Factory #1
- Função Factory #2
- Classe Vs Função Factory
- Desafio Função Constrututora
- IIFE
- Call & Apply
Java Script: Exercícios
- Soma, Subtração, Multiplicação e Divisão.
- Classificação dos Triângulos.
- Base Elevada ao Expoente.
- Resultado e o Resto.
- Dinheiro de Forma Correta.
- Juros Simples e Compostos.
- Fórmula de Bhaskara.
- Vetor de Pontuação.
- Sistema de Notas.
- Divisível por 3.
- Anos Bissextos.
- Fatorial de um Número.
- Dia Útil.
- Condicional Switch.
- Revenda.
- Calculadora Básica.
- Aumento de Salário.
- Número por Extenso.
- Lanchonete.
- Mínimo de Cédulas.
- Plano de Saúde.
- Pagamento de Anuidade.
- Média Ponderada.
- 11 vezes Hello World.
- 1 até 150.
- Pares entre 1 e 100.
- Altura e Taxa de Crescimento.
- Pares e Ímpares.
- Vetor - Intervalo.
- Vetor - Maior e Menor.
- Vetor - Números Negativos.
- Vetor - Média Aritmética.
- Vetor - Três Vetores.
- True ou False.
- Dois Vetores.
- Duas Funções - Vetores.
- Duas Funções - Progressão Aritmética.
- Imprimindo Números Ímpares.
- Trocando Elementos.
- Função - Vetor de Notas.
Anotações
npm install -g nodemon npm install --save-dev nodemon npm config get prefix set PATH=%PATH%;C:\Users\"Aqui seu usuario"\AppData\Roaming\npm; Permissão: Set-ExecutionPolicy RemoteSigned